cpu: Use std::abs() in traffic_gen.cc.

When building with clang with the --without-tcmalloc flag set, the
-fno-builtin flag is not used, and clang can then detect that the
integer version of abs(), apparently the C version, is being used on a
floating point value in traffic_gen.cc.

This change takes clang's suggestion to use std::abs instead, and also
includes a header file which will provide it.
